Functional Requirements
Based on the product definition, the water flosser requires:
Motor-driven pulsation to generate water pressure.
Wireless connectivity (Bluetooth/Wi-Fi) to synchronize with a mobile application.
Rechargeable power supply for portability and ease of use.
System Architecture
From the structural layout, the product must integrate:
A rechargeable lithium battery as the main power source.
A high-speed motor and pump system, capable of converting stored energy into stable pulsed water pressure.
Power management and safety circuitry to ensure reliable charging and discharging cycles.
Wireless MCU to handle both motor control and mobile connectivity.
Power Management & Charging Circuit
During charging:
IC1 acts as a front-line protection IC, monitoring the USB input and validating safe voltage levels before allowing current flow.
Once validated, IC2 serves as the dedicated charging IC, regulating the charging current into the lithium battery.
Throughout the cycle, IC3 monitors the battery state, providing safeguards against overcharging.
During operation:
The IC3 also prevents over-discharge and overcurrent during battery use.
A low-dropout regulator (IC4) ensures stable 3V supply to the control circuitry.
This regulated voltage powers the IC5 SoC, which manages system logic and communication.
Control & Communication
The IC5 microcontroller is the central controller, responsible for interpreting user input from physical buttons or commands sent via the mobile app.
It computes required motor output and signals the motor driver IC to control the water pump motor accordingly.
Simultaneously, the IC5’s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) module maintains a seamless connection with the smartphone application, enabling real-time control and data synchronization.
